🥒🍅 Growing More Than Gardens at WES! 🍅🥒

Our first-grade PBL driving question this year was: How can we grow fresh vegetables to support our Backpack Buddies community?

Our students put their learning into action by creating a plan to help make sure Backpack Buddies families would have fresh food throughout the summer. They planted seeds, cared for their plants, and proudly watched them grow into thriving tomato and cucumber plants.

Today, students delivered the plants along with beautiful informational brochures created by our talented 5th grade students. Families also received orange buckets that were generously donated by Home Depot — a huge thank you to Mrs. Berger’s husband for helping support this meaningful project!

We are so proud of our students for showing kindness, teamwork, and servant leadership while making a difference in our community. 💙💛

This year, the yearbook was dedicated to two faculty members who will be retiring this year. 💙💛

Mrs. Turley has been a treasured part of our WES family for 22 out of her 29 years in education. She has inspired countless students and teachers with her deep knowledge of language arts, her enthusiasm for reading, and her unwavering commitment to student success. Mrs. Turley has a special gift for building lasting relationships with her students, many of whom still look up to her long after they left her classroom. Her passion, positivity, and joyful spirit have made a lasting impact on our school. Her legacy will continue to inspire us for years to come.

Mrs. Wills has dedicated 25 years to education, including the past 12 years at WES. During her time here, she has been an invaluable member of our exceptional education team. Mrs. Wills works seamlessly with her colleagues, and her classroom is a place where her students feel safe, supported, and encouraged — not only academically, but through the life lessons she so faithfully shares. Mrs. Wills, we will truly miss your sweet spirit, your dedication to students, and the laughter you bring to our school.

📚🎉 WES READ-A-THON SUCCESS! 🎉📚

WOW! In just 2 weeks, our WES students read an incredible 16,610 minutes! 📖

Not only did our students show a love for reading, but together we also raised 50% of the cost for our Book Vending Machine! Incredible! Thank you for supporting our very first Read-A-Thon and helping us move closer to this exciting goal for our students. 💙💛

Our top class in donations was Mrs. Craig’s class with an outstanding $825 raised! 💰
Our top class in reading minutes was also Mrs. Craig’s class with 3,534 minutes read! 📚

Because of their hard work and dedication, Mrs. Craig’s class will enjoy a pizza party! 🍕

While we did not fully fund the vending machine this year, we are excited to continue working toward our goal with a different fundraiser next year.

Thank you so much to our amazing students, families, staff, and supporters for making our 1st Read-A-Thon such a success. Our WES students and parents are truly AMAZING! ❤️
